I recently visited Tikka indian Grill with a small group of five, and while the food was decent, the experience left a bad taste in my mouth. They added a mandatory 20% “large party fee” to our bill, which I found excessive given that we were only five people—not exactly a “large party.” I wouldn’t have minded tipping generously if the service had been exceptional, but we weren’t even provided with a proper receipt to review the charges.
Transparency is key when it comes to dining out, and this felt like an unfair cash grab. If you’re going to enforce charges like this, at least communicate clearly and give customers the ability to see what they’re paying for.
Unfortunately, I won’t be returning or recommending this place to others. Dining out should feel enjoyable, not like you’re being taken advantage of.
